Megan Hauptman is a Bernstein Fellow at the National Immigration Project of the National Lawyers Guild (NIPNLG). Prior to beginning her fellowship with NIPNLG, Megan clerked for the Hon. Diana Saldaña of the Southern District of Texas. She is a 2021 graduate of Yale Law School, where she was an editor for the Yale Law & Policy Review and participated in several clinics focused on immigration, criminal defense, and human rights advocacy. Prior to law school, she worked as a paralegal for a public defender's office. She holds a B.A. from Brown University.
